Porter Press International (PPI) was founded in 2005 by acclaimed automotive author Philip Porter. Together with his wife Julie, Philip has built the business and today it is the leading publisher of specialist automotive titles. The business is run from restored barns on the site of the Porter's Tudor farmhouse in Tenbury Wells in rural Worcestershire.
